How Does Dilemma Intervention Work?
The primary step in dilemma intervention involves ensuring that the customer is risk-free. This can include evaluating for factors like frustration or accessibility to hazardous objects.


The next step includes discovering more about the client's present issues. This is usually done through active listening and compassion. This can aid the situation responder determine exactly how the scenario rose to a crisis.

De-escalation
Numerous elements can trigger a person to get in a state of crisis. These factors may include a loss of control, absence of sources or sensations of anxiety and anxiety. Typically, people who remain in a state of situation need immediate help and support.

To de-escalate a crisis circumstance, the primary step is to make certain that the customer is secure and secure. This can include getting them into a mental health and wellness facility or various other therapy program. It might also involve supplying help and solutions, such as sanctuary and food.

As soon as the customer is securely in a risk-free setting, the situation intervention worker can begin evaluating their feelings and demands. This entails reviewing the speeding up occasion, the customer's understandings of the significance and factor of the occurrence, and the quantity of subjective distress. This info will assist the dilemma intervention worker develop an action strategy to decrease distress and boost operating. They might additionally ask the customer to recommend healthy or adaptive cognitions regarding their current situation.

Analytical
The problem-solving procedure assists people identify issues and make plans to resolve them. It is an important part of crisis treatment. This procedure involves reviewing lethality, developing rapport, and reviewing the dilemma situation. It additionally includes energetic listening and compassion. This type of paying attention is a vital action in the dilemma intervention procedure since it needs you to place the client and their sensations first. It also urges you to eliminate any kind of predispositions and judgment that could hinder of establishing a trusting connection.

It is important to examine the client's assumption and interpretation of the occasion that caused the crisis. The dilemma worker must work to determine and address cognitive mistakes and help the customer develop an extra adaptive context. This may entail talking about favorable coping techniques, which can be useful in minimizing the level of distress. It can likewise involve checking out alternative coping methods that the client may have attempted.

Follow-up
During this action, the crisis treatment worker assists clients determine their sources and support group. They additionally motivate the customer to use flexible coping strategies. They likewise reframe their negative thinking patterns and help them establish practical frames of reference for the scenario.

In this step, the dilemma employee validates the customer's feelings and experiences and assures them that they will certainly get better. This action additionally includes developing a genuine positive respect for the client and showing that they appreciate them.

It is necessary for the client to really feel safe and comfortable. To accomplish this, the crisis counselor need to show empathy and energetic listening abilities. Then, they need to aid the client determine any kind of triggers for suicidal thoughts. Lastly, they have to offer a follow-up strategy to stop suicide and offer references if necessary.
